 V-Color reveals DDR5 memory sticks with integrated displays

At Computex 2025, V-Color demonstrated unusual Xfinity Manta RAM modules (DDR5 DIMM). Their main feature was a built-in LCD display that allows to monitor key RAM parameters: volume and temperature, as well as data on speed and operating voltage.

 G.Skill has released a set of 256GB high-speed DDR5 modules

G.Skill has unveiled a set of four Trident Z5 Neo RGB DDR5 memory cards with an atypically large total capacity of 256GB. It is aimed at cyber athletes, AI developers and other professionals. The manufacturer also published screenshots with tests of the kit in several configurations.

 XPG sets new world record for DDR5 memory overclocking

XPG, in collaboration with GIGABYTE Technology, has managed to overclock its LANCER RGB DDR5 RAM module to 12,762 MT/s, setting a world record. The test was conducted by GIGABYTE's renowned overclocker and engineer HiCookie.
